How Do You Provision a 500-Switch Network in a Few Days?
One of the interesting aspects of a IT event the scale of Cisco Live is that it has its own unique set of IT challenges. During a behind the scenes tour during Tech Field Day Extra at Cisco Live US 2019, Ivan Pepelnjak got to ask how they created the network for the event in such a short amount of time. What he found was that provisioning a large campus network in a few days is easy and reliable as long as you do your homework and keep things as simple as possible.

Stephen Foskett Gets the Latest News From Commvault at Commvault GO 2019
Stephen Foskett is interviewing Commvault management to learn the latest news at Tech Field Day Exclusive at Commvault GO 2019 in Denver. Commvault recently acquired Hedvig, a software-defined storage company, and is enhancing its backup offerings with this highly-integrated, scalable storage solution. The company also announced Metallic, a new software-as-a-service offering.

Why You Should Consider Software-Defined Storage in Your Data Center
Datacenter architectures must meet the changing needs of many applications, while also supporting demanding workloads today. Datera’s design focuses on data movement, to allow flexibility for growth as requirements change. It uses commodity hardware and machine learning to create an optimal and cost-effective storage platform for the modern datacenter. Stephen Foskett breaks down their approach based on Datera’s presentations at Storage Field Day and Tech Field Day.
